Artwork

Treść dostarczona przez Frontend First, Sam Selikoff, and Ryan Toronto. Cała zawartość podcastów, w tym odcinki, grafika i opisy podcastów, jest przesyłana i udostępniana bezpośrednio przez Frontend First, Sam Selikoff, and Ryan Toronto lub jego partnera na platformie podcastów. Jeśli uważasz, że ktoś wykorzystuje Twoje dzieło chronione prawem autorskim bez Twojej zgody, możesz postępować zgodnie z procedurą opisaną tutaj https://pl.player.fm/legal.
Player FM - aplikacja do podcastów
Przejdź do trybu offline z Player FM !

Should a navigation and a refresh show the same page?

45:05
 
Udostępnij
 

Manage episode 377524013 series 1635850
Treść dostarczona przez Frontend First, Sam Selikoff, and Ryan Toronto. Cała zawartość podcastów, w tym odcinki, grafika i opisy podcastów, jest przesyłana i udostępniana bezpośrednio przez Frontend First, Sam Selikoff, and Ryan Toronto lub jego partnera na platformie podcastów. Jeśli uważasz, że ktoś wykorzystuje Twoje dzieło chronione prawem autorskim bez Twojej zgody, możesz postępować zgodnie z procedurą opisaną tutaj https://pl.player.fm/legal.

Ryan and Sam talk about how to invalidate Next.js’ client-side cache when a different session makes changes to backend data, and ultimately discuss whether clicking a link to a URL vs. hitting refresh on that same URL should render the same page if no backend data has changed.

Topics include:

  • 0:00 - Intro
  • 1:00 - Suspense boundary identity and the Await component
  • 11:07 - How to refresh RSC using a Server Action
  • 27:17 - The difference between a navigation and a page refresh

Links:

  continue reading

201 odcinków

Artwork
iconUdostępnij
 
Manage episode 377524013 series 1635850
Treść dostarczona przez Frontend First, Sam Selikoff, and Ryan Toronto. Cała zawartość podcastów, w tym odcinki, grafika i opisy podcastów, jest przesyłana i udostępniana bezpośrednio przez Frontend First, Sam Selikoff, and Ryan Toronto lub jego partnera na platformie podcastów. Jeśli uważasz, że ktoś wykorzystuje Twoje dzieło chronione prawem autorskim bez Twojej zgody, możesz postępować zgodnie z procedurą opisaną tutaj https://pl.player.fm/legal.

Ryan and Sam talk about how to invalidate Next.js’ client-side cache when a different session makes changes to backend data, and ultimately discuss whether clicking a link to a URL vs. hitting refresh on that same URL should render the same page if no backend data has changed.

Topics include:

  • 0:00 - Intro
  • 1:00 - Suspense boundary identity and the Await component
  • 11:07 - How to refresh RSC using a Server Action
  • 27:17 - The difference between a navigation and a page refresh

Links:

  continue reading

201 odcinków

Alle episoder

×
 
Loading …

Zapraszamy w Player FM

Odtwarzacz FM skanuje sieć w poszukiwaniu wysokiej jakości podcastów, abyś mógł się nią cieszyć już teraz. To najlepsza aplikacja do podcastów, działająca na Androidzie, iPhonie i Internecie. Zarejestruj się, aby zsynchronizować subskrypcje na różnych urządzeniach.

 

Skrócona instrukcja obsługi

Posłuchaj tego programu podczas zwiedzania
Odtwarzanie